A laser printer containing a new toner cartridge was set to constantly print a black A4 document until the toner ran empty and a pure white sheet emerged, unprinted. As the pages exited the printer, I stacked them face up. The completed stack of paper contains the entire contents of the toner cartridge. The bottom page is black, the top page is white, and between is the transition—demise, depletion, expiration—from black to blank, full to empty.
